Output 8c321fa93229b429caa10cb8b0d418ba0f72e55e701d076922657c4ad779866b:28

value
1013327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ae2cfa52cd2a151702f779e7cc6b62a964e6b6a OP_EQUAL
address
349BCeJ6ZPEVKsph6iNfkCYuz94ZRtWNFv
transaction
8c321fa93229b429caa10cb8b0d418ba0f72e55e701d076922657c4ad779866b
spent
true